Every Week at Brasil

Sundays: Keith Karnaky, Bill Miller, and a Rotating Mystery Guest 8-11pm
Led by drummer Keith Karnaky and bassist Bill Miller they will feature quality artists that 'want to enjoy themselves...play their hearts out...are happy... to play throwing their hearts to the wind'. We have in the past had a philosophy to hire the best Houston players....and invite them to play with less restrictions than usual....often free or spontaneous in composition. This philosophy continues at Brasil. Please join us and tell others so that this night remains healthy as a place to enjoy.
